Vital Abilities for Aspiring Full-Stack Developers
To do well in full-stack development, aiming designers have to cultivate a diverse collection of skills that span both front-end and back-end innovations. Efficiency in HTML, CSS, and JavaScript is essential for crafting appealing interface. Recognizing structures such as React or Angular boosts their capability to construct vibrant applications. On the backside, experience with server-side languages like Node.js, Python, or Ruby is essential, in addition to understanding of data source administration using SQL or NoSQL systems.Additionally, aspiring full-stack developers should grasp variation control systems, particularly Git, to successfully handle code adjustments. They need to likewise appreciate Relaxed APIs and how to integrate them right into applications. Knowledge with receptive layout principles warranties usability throughout devices. Strong analytical abilities and a strong understanding of software program growth methodologies are essential for navigating complex jobs. By grasping these abilities, aiming programmers place themselves for success in the affordable landscape of full-stack development.
Devices and Technologies in Full-Stack Development
A range of devices and innovations play crucial duties in the full-stack growth procedure. Front-end development typically entails frameworks such as React, Angular, or Vue.js, which make it possible for designers to produce vibrant interface. For styling, CSS preprocessors like SASS and tools like Bootstrap improve the style procedure. On the back end, innovations like Node.js, Python with Django, or Ruby on check my site Rails are generally made use of to take care of server-side logic. Data sources, consisting of SQL (MySQL, PostgreSQL) and NoSQL (MongoDB), are vital for data storage space and retrieval.Additionally, version control systems, dramatically Git, are important for cooperation and handling code modifications. Developers commonly take advantage of cloud services such as AWS or Azure to deploy applications, making certain scalability and dependability. Continuous integration and deployment (CI/CD) tools further enhance the advancement workflow by automating testing and implementation processes. Jointly, these devices make it possible for full-stack developers to construct efficient, contemporary applications that fulfill varied individual needs.
